Describing something that has spines or sharp points sticking out from it.
The spined creature moved cautiously through the underbrush.
Spined → It is formed from "spine" (from Latin *spina*, meaning thorn or spine) and the suffix "-ed" (indicating a condition or state). The word "spined" refers to something that has spines or is characterized by spines.
